課題組簡介
研究方向:
環(huán)境微生物
研究內容:
環(huán)境微生物資源挖掘及高效功能微生物菌種選育;微生物強化有機固廢定向生物轉化技術;多組學分析有機固廢生物轉化過程中物質結構變化規(guī)律與微生物代謝調控作用機制。
研究成果展示
構建了適用于有機廢棄物處理和污染物降解的環(huán)境微生物菌種庫,并將功能微生物成功應用于餐廚垃圾高溫好氧生物減量、農業(yè)廢棄物高溫堆肥發(fā)酵、畜禽養(yǎng)殖廢水生化處理、鹽堿地改良等領域,利用(宏)組學技術解析了有機固廢生物轉化過程中微生物群落演替規(guī)律、微生物代謝特征及產物定向調控機制。主持國家自然科學基金、國家重點研發(fā)計劃課題、中國科學院、上海市科委、中科院-福建STS項目等50余項,發(fā)表論文120余篇,申請專利50余項。
